Religious Trauma Support Group

January 2, 2027 @ 11:00 am - 1:00 pm CST

A Monthly Religious Trauma Support Group Facilitated by an LGBTQIA+ Certified Peer Support Specialist

Are you navigating the aftermath of religious trauma, spiritual abuse, or the painful intersections of faith and identity? You’re not alone.

This peer-led support group offers a safe, affirming space for individuals who have experienced religious trauma—particularly those from LGBTQIA+ communities. Facilitated by a certified peer support specialist with lived experience and specialized training in both religious trauma and LGBTQIA+ issues, this group provides a judgment-free environment to share, heal, and grow.

Together, we explore topics such as:

Reclaiming identity and self-worth
Processing grief, fear, and shame
Deconstructing harmful beliefs
Navigating relationships with family and community
Cultivating new spiritual or secular paths
Whether you’re newly deconstructing or have been on this journey for years, you’re welcome here.

Confidential. Peer-led. Affirming. Healing.
